SOUTH SAN FRANCISCO, Calif., May 08, 2017 -- Cytokinetics, Incorporated (Nasdaq:CYTK) today announced the pricing of an underwritten public offering of 5,260,000 shares of its common stock at a price to the public of $14.25 per share, before underwriting discounts and commissions. The gross proceeds to Cytokinetics from the offering, before deducting underwriting discounts and commissions and other offering expenses payable by Cytokinetics, are expected to be to be approximately $75.0 million. The offering is expected to close on May 12, 2017, subject to customary closing conditions. Additionally, Cytokinetics granted the underwriter a 30-day option to purchase up to an additional 789,000 shares of common stock at the public offering price, less underwriting discounts and commissions. All of the shares of common stock in the offering will be sold by Cytokinetics.
Morgan Stanley is acting as sole underwriter for the offering. A registration statement related to the offering has been fil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ission (the “SEC”). About Cytokinetics
Cytokinetics is a late-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on discovering, developing and commercializing first-in-class muscle activators as potential treatments for debilitating diseases in which muscle performance is compromised and/or declining.
